-- <strong>Queneau</strong>'s supposed dislike of or disinterest in music has to be tempered somewhat<br />

by the presence of music in <strong>Zazie</strong> <strong>dans</strong> <strong>le</strong> métro, among other works. Bach's fugues<br />

are said to be at the root of the Exercices (cf. <strong>Queneau</strong>, Preface to Exercices de<br />

sty<strong>le</strong>), of which a number were put to music. Loin de Rueil was made into a musical<br />

by Pillaudin. <strong>Queneau</strong> wrote the lyrics for "La Croqueuse de diamants," "Gervaise,"<br />

and "Le Vélo magique." And Juliette Gréco made a hit of <strong>Queneau</strong>'s "Si tu<br />

t'imagines..." at Sartre's suggestion (but see her entry in the bibliographical index).<br />

-- There was a group which worked on music in the same way that the Oulipo works<br />

on literature. <strong>Cf</strong>. Noël Arnaud, "Littérature combinatoire," p. 694, and the<br />

"Oulipo" entry.<br />

-- There are some sort of manuscripts availab<strong>le</strong> at the CDRQ under the tit<strong>le</strong>s "Chansons<br />

d'écrivains," "Ma vie en musique," and "Quel<strong>le</strong> est donc cette éclaircie."<br />
